Rapid access to fluorene-9-carboxamides through palladium-catalysed cross-dehydrogenative coupling

Abstract

Herein, we describe a facile synthesis of fluorene-9-carboxamides through a palladium-catalysed intramolecular cross-dehydrogenative aryl–aryl coupling reaction. The reaction features mild reaction conditions, a broad substrate scope, and simplicity of operation, constituting an interesting shortcut to access fluorene compounds.
